The Ethiopian Herald Wednesday January 30, 2019

Invitation for Bid

The Federal Democratic Republic of Ethiopia

Ethiopian Electric Utility

Universal Electricity Access Program

Ethiopian Electrification Program (ELEAP) Project

Procurement of 15 KV & 33 KV Distribution Transformers and Working Tools and safety Equipments

Loan No./Credit No./ Grant No.: IDA- 6157 & IDA -6158

TENDER No: Lot 9, WB EEU-UEAP /009/18 (ICB), and Lot 10 WB EEU-UEAP /010/18 (ICB)

1) Lot 9 is for procurement of 15 KV & 33 KV Distribution Transformers

2) Lot 10 is for procurement of Working Tools and safety Equipments

The Federal Government of Ethiopia has received a credit from the International Development Association (IDA) toward the cost of
Ethiopian Electrification Program (ELEAP) Project, and it intends to apply part of the proceeds of this credit to payments under the
Contract for Procurement of 15 KV & 33 KV Distribution Transformers and Working Tools & safety Equipments

Tendering will be conducted through international competitive Bidding (ICB) and is open to all eligible Bidders.

1. The Ethiopian Electric Utility (EEU) now invites sealed bids from eligible bidders for the supply of 15 KV & 33 KV Distribution
Transformers and Working Tools & safety Equipments

2. Interested eligible Bidders may obtain further information and inspect the bidding documents during office hours (i.e. from 08:00
to 17:00 hours) at the address given below

Ethiopian Electric Utility UEAP, Procurement Office Berges Building 3rd floor

Tel: +251-11-1263154 Fax:-+251 -11-1263181 Addis Ababa, Ethiopia

3. A complete set of the Bidding documents in English may be purchased by interested Bidders from the address above upon
payment of a nonrefundable fee of ETB 4,000.00 (Ethiopian Birr Four Thousands) for each Lot starting from January 31, 2019.

4. Bids must be delivered to the address above on or before March 19, 2019 at 14:00 hour, local time. Late bids will be rejected.
Bids will be opened in the presence of the bidders' representatives who choose to attend in person. Bids will be publicly opened in
the presence of the Bidders' designated representatives and anyone who chooses to attend at UEAP Office near In Bekentu Bridge,
Berges Building 5th Floor, UEAP Meeting Hall on March 19, 2019 at 14:30.

5. All Bids must be accompanied by a bid security and it shall be unconditional Bank guarantee from a reputable Bank and must be
counter guaranteed by the Commercial Bank of Ethiopia and it remains valid for a period of Twenty Eighty (28) days beyond the
original bid validity period. The amount and currency of the bid security shall be USD 88,600.00 (United States Dollars Eighty Eight
Thousands Six hundred) for Lot 9 and USD 59,000.00 (United States Dollars Fifty Nine Thousands) for Lot 10.

6. The bidder can quote maximum for both Lots. But the offer for each lot shall be submitted independently.

7. The Ethiopian Electric Utility Universal Electricity access Program reserves the right to reject all or part of this bid.
